Experts Weigh in on the PR Job Market Right Now, and What It Will Look Like Later This Year

PRSay

For PR professionals, the job market “is going to be rough” in the second quarter of this year, said panelist Jessamyn Katz , president of the San Francisco office of Heyman Associates, a communications and marketing recruiter. There will be a huge pent-up demand for communications after companies start hiring again,” Katz said.
